**Job Summary and Responsibilities**
Assists in patient care and preparation of surgical patients; Performs scrub duties and related procedures; Accountable for ensuring cleaning and maintenance of supplies and equipment for selected specialty. Performs in the advanced roles of preceptor, service specialist and instrument room liaison.
1. Assist surgical team in the scrubbing role according CHI St. Luke's policies and procedures.
2. Maintain sterile field.
3. Report immediately any breaks in aseptic technique.
4. Pass instruments, suture products, medication, and sponge materials to surgeon.
5. Assist with retracting of tissue and organs, and suctioning by holding the retracting

**Job Requirements**
**_Required Education and Experience_**
*High School Diploma/GED
*Certified Surgical Technologist (CST) or Certified Surgical First Assistant (CST/CSFA) required as of September 1, 2010 or "grandfathered" employees or LVN
BCLS for some locations
*One (1) year of experience
